Two days later, Han Xinrui boarded the train with Political Commissar Li.
This time, Political Commissar Li returned to the fertilizer plant obviously with a mission.
On the way back, she felt that many people were following them.
Han Xinrui wasn't a slow-witted person. She felt the pressure and hesitantly asked Political Commissar Li, "Political Commissar Li, do you have anything else to do at the fertilizer factory this time?"
Political Commissar Li was silent for a moment: "We want to take you back to find something!"
Han Xinrui asked doubtfully, "The Huo family's things? Huo Dahai won't tell me."
Political Commissar Li sighed softly, "It's not the Huo family's stuff, it's your father's stuff! He must have discovered something and that's why it happened by accident."
The fertilizer factory's investigation results showed that Huo Dahai was afraid that the evidence of his corruption would be handed over by Han's father, so he tampered with the greenhouse.
But the reality is not that simple.
"What on earth are you looking for? There's nothing unusual in my parents' belongings except the notebook." Han Xinrui recalled her parents' belongings.
Her parents didn't leave her much, most of it was money and gold bars!
Then, Han Xinrui suddenly realized: her parents' income is fixed, so why can they give her so many gold bars?
Political Commissar Li noticed that her expression was not right and asked Han Xinrui, "Han girl, what's wrong?"
Han Xinrui was silent for a moment before she said, "My parents left me some gold bars, but the strange thing is, my parents' salaries at the fertilizer factory are fixed. They are both from an ordinary family, so how could they have so many gold bars?"
Political Commissar Li also suddenly realized: "Han girl, where are the gold bars?"
Han Xinrui rummaged through the package and pulled out a few patched clothes.
She opened two of the suits and pulled out two small yellow croakers. "Commissar Li, these are gold bars. I was afraid someone would notice them, so I sewed them into the lining of my clothes. There's no one in the compound, so I'm carrying them with me."
Political Commissar Li took the small yellow croaker and looked at it carefully.
Then, he weighed it in his hand and said, "No, this doesn't look real."
He waved over two guards, gave them the things, and told them to go down and smash them open when the train stopped.
When they came up again, they found that the small yellow croaker was hollow and there was nothing hidden inside.
Han Xinrui looked at these fake things and felt very confused.
"Maybe it's not small yellow croaker!" Political Commissar Li returned the thing to Han Xinrui.
Han Xinrui looked at the things in her hand and looked at them again and again: "These don't seem to be my small yellow croakers!"
Upon hearing this, Political Commissar Li asked in confusion, "It's not yours?"
Han Xinrui was silent for a moment, then said in a deep voice, "Huo Hongtao gave my gold bars to Bai Qingqing. Later, after I made a scene, Bai Qingqing returned some of them to me. These small yellow croakers were returned to me by Bai Qingqing. I can't tell if they're real. Could it be that the small yellow croakers were already replaced?"
When Political Commissar Li heard this, his expression turned grim: "It's not impossible!"
Han Xinrui took out all the small yellow croakers from her clothes.
She gave all the remaining gold bars to Political Commissar Li.
Political Commissar Li ordered people to smash all the gold bars!
It's all fake!
Han Xinrui wasn't sure whether the things her parents gave her were fake, or whether they had been replaced by Huo Hongtao, or even by Bai Qingqing.
Political Commissar Li asked Han Xinrui again, "Have you given these things to Huo Dahai and his wife?"
Han Xinrui shook her head. "To demonstrate their virtue, they didn't ask me for the gold bars. I had always been obedient to Huo Hongtao, so they must have thought they would get the gold bars sooner or later, so they didn't ask me for it right away."
